Ubuntu 22.04 üzerine Certbot’un nasıl kurulacağını aşağıdaki adımlarla anlatabilirim. Certbot, Let’s Encrypt tarafından sunulan ve ücretsiz SSL/TLS sertifikalarını yönetmek için kullanılan bir araçtır.
Adım 1: Certbot Kurulumu
Certbot’u kurmak için, aşağıdaki komutları kullanarak Universe depolarını etkinleştirin ve Certbot’u yükleyin:
sudo add-apt-repository universe
sudo apt update
sudo apt install certbot python3-certbot-apache
Adım 2: Sertifika Talebi Oluşturun
Certbot, sertifika taleplerini kolayca yönetmenizi sağlar. Önceki adımlarda Apache’yi kurduysanız ve sanal bir ana bilgisayar yapılandırması yaptıysanız, Certbot ile sertifika oluşturmak oldukça kolaydır.
Aşağıdaki komutu kullanarak, Certbot ile bir sertifika talebi oluşturun:
sudo certbot –apache
Bu komut, Certbot’u Apache ile etkileşimli bir şekilde çalıştırarak alan adınız için bir sertifika talep eder. Sistem size alan adınızı seçmenizi ve başka bir yapılandırma yapmanız gerekip gerekmediğini soracaktır.
Adım 3: Sertifika Yenileme
Let’s Encrypt sertifikaları genellikle 90 gün süre ile geçerlidir. Sertifikalarınızın otomatik olarak yenilenmesini sağlamak için Certbot’un otomatik yenileme görevini kullanmanız önemlidir.
Certbot, aşağıdaki komutla sertifikalarınızı otomatik olarak yenileyebilir:
sudo certbot renew
Bu komutu crontab gibi bir zamanlayıcıyla kullanarak sertifikalarınızı düzenli aralıklarla otomatik olarak yenileyebilirsiniz. Örneğin, her gün sertifikalarınızın yenilenmesini sağlamak için aşağıdaki gibi bir crontab görevi oluşturabilirsiniz:
sudo crontab -e
Ardından crontab dosyasının içine aşağıdaki satırı ekleyin:
0 0 * * * /usr/bin/certbot renew
Bu satır, her gece saat 00:00’da sertifikalarınızın yenilenmesini sağlayacaktır.
Artık Ubuntu 22.04 üzerinde Certbot’u başarıyla kurmuş ve SSL/TLS sertifikalarınızı yönetmek için kullanabilirsiniz. Sertifikalarınızın düzenli olarak yenilendiğinden emin olun ve web sitenizin güvende olduğundan emin olun.
Bir yanıt yazın
Yorum yapabilmek için oturum açmalısınız.